When is the best spot to re-raise a potential bluffer who is in 90% of the hands played and stealing pots? This is on any table be it tournament or ring tables.:confused:

Should you show your bluffs or is there certain spots in a tourney to do this? Ring games?:confused:



There have been many theories about bluffing, and many readings to do.

Basically.......When you have the option, never, EVER, show anything! As soon as you show your opponent your cards, you are giving out information. If you never show your hand, they will never know. You have given them no information of any type, and that's is an absolute advantage for you.
